Santa Monica Business Mixer a Huge Success

What to do? In a difficult economy, should a small business increase marketing efforts or hunker down? The LeTip Santa Monica Chapter thinks it has one answer. Join with a group of other business owners and professionals to trade referrals, which costs only time and a few bucks for a great breakfast.

So while the current membership does this every Wednesday morning, they decided to invite a 100 or so others to come and see what a meeting looks like. "There was a great turnout, and several of those attending seemed inclined to come back and take a second look," said membership chair, Randy Kirk, who also is the marketing consultant for the club.


Jordan Hoffman, acupuncturist for the group, and this year's president gives this thought: "Almost every one you talk to is in a cash squeeze, but almost everyone I talk to has more free time then they did a year ago. We meet before the business day starts at 7:00 a.m. By the time I hit the office at 9:00, I may already have a hot lead for a new client."

LeTip meetings are about far more than passing tips, but it is the main reason for getting together. Each member is required to pass 4 tips each month. It only stands to reason that the average member is therefore going to receive 4 tips each month.
